Hi,

I have tried to install YDL 2, and now YDL 3 on several machines, with
not much
success.

My latest attempt at an installation:

YDL 3 on a Power Center 150, lots of ram, YDL installed on a 3 gig SCSI
external
hard drive, Applevision 17 monitor.  Both attempts started with a clean
hard
drive, low level format, all data zeroed.

Attempt #1...Installation went fine. Installation program worked great.
I
specified graphical login screen.  Booted in Linux, and screen went
black (with
maybe one or two flickers of some text) when it got to the graphical
login.

Attempt #2...Installatin went fine.  Installation program worked great.
I
specified text login screen.  Booted in Linux, and text-based login and
password
prompts came as expected.  Screen went black, but you could tell that
KDE was
loading because it made that little rhythmical sound while loading the
KDE desktop.

So obviously YDL does not like the video settings of some sort.  I've
specified
both 800 x 600 and thousands of colors, and 1024 x 768 and thousands of
colors.
 I didn't know how much video ram to specify during YDL installation,
because I
don't know how to figure that out.  The default was 2 megs, so I went
with that.

Any clues?  I really would like to get YDL running on SOMETHING.  I also
tried
on an all-in-one-beige-G3, but it would only show the installation
program in
distorted weird colors, on the left half of the screen.
